Stereo Technical Assistant, Temp (Blue Sky Studios)
JOB DESCRIPTION
Essential Functions/Responsibilities:
• Support and troubleshoot 3D sets, Stereo Finishing and pipeline related issues with Stereoscopic Supervisor, Rendering Supervisor, Stereoscopic TDs, and Render TDs
• Track and work on Camera/Staging (workbook/Final Layout), Animation (in progress and Final), Lighting and Compositing files camera issues.
• Basic Stereoscopic Camera setup
• Technical check set up/prep for render
• Troubleshooting problematic left eye renders, Quality Control post render
• Stereo finishing shot set up/ trouble shooting
• Rendering tools development/execution
• Support Stereoscopic TDs on creative tasks such as Stereoscopic Camera setup Creative Left eye Render
• Maintains a consistent level of productivity while meeting deadlines and producing high quality work
Qualifications:
Education and/or Experience Required:
• Bachelor's degree or equivalent degree in Computer Science, Computer Visualization, or Computer Animation required or equivalent work experience.
• Demonstrated expertise in Camera/Staging and/or compositing
• Familiarity with scripting concepts (C-Shell, Perl, Python, RenderMan, MEL and/or similar).
• Familiarity with one or more animation package (Maya, Softimage, etc.)
• Familiarity with one or more compositing package (Shake, Nuke, etc.)
• Familiarity with Linux operating systems.
• Experience working in production environment preferred.
Skills
, Abilities, Special Licenses or Certificate
• Ability to manage resources to achieve aesthetic goals on schedule.
• Strong problem-solving skills
• Must be able to work collaboratively
• Must be able to take direction and embrace change
Working Conditions and Environment/ Physical Demands
• Work for a 24/7 Animation Studio
• Office working environment
• Must be able to physically fuse stereoscopic imagery for extended periods of time
• Walking/bending/sitting/standing
• Works at the front and back end of the production pipeline with hard deadlines and high productivity demands and, as such, flexible working hours during ''crunch periods'', including evenings and weekends.
